Default Wrong cpuid

Hello,

My A100 is stuck at the android logo, but never loads.
I have tried the EEUs that is available here (thanks), but because I can only connect in APX mode, the CPUID.txt file is never created. Thus when I enter my correct CPUID the program says it is incorrect.

Can anyone upload the contents from the CPUID.txt file, or perhaps recommend a tutorial on using NVFLASH included in the Image folder of the EEUs file?

Any help would be greatly appreciated, as my a100 is a total brick.

Hi. Thanks for looking.

According to all of the tutorials I have read it should be in a folder called 7zXXXX.tmp in c:\users\(username)\appdata\local\temp

Unless my info is outdated and te program doesn't create it anymore, but according to the A500 forum you have to enter the CPUID into the CPUID.txt file when the temp directory is created, WHILE the program is still running.

I've solved putting update.zip into the SDcard and running recovery at startup.
Before using this system the tab remains with the android symbol with the " ! " inside it and nothing happen. After that, I've erased any data in the SD, placed update.zip in it and powered up using power button+left volume, or right, I don't remamber. But finally it works.
